Why dont HCS lock the gold stolen by thieves so as the player can get it back for a period of time. Its not like its the gold from mobs and monsters its a completely different string, and could be lock like guild xp. Wouldn't if be ironic even funny that a thief gets attacked for gold no one but the person he stole from could get!!!
This may not be liked by the bounty hunters so how about the money locked and that money be returned to the bountier rather than them losing from thieves and then payin more to get nothin back!!! This way the bounties would be doing what they should, not only deleveling but the attacker would gain nothing aswell!!
I say this as people say how can i buy fsp's when i get attacked because i can not hold the money in my bank i need it active. Ofcourse HCS could allow money being held in your bank be used for buying fsp's aswell !!
